Health visiting: giving children the best start in life

The health visiting service plays a crucial role in giving children the best start in life and councils have embraced the opportunity to make a difference in this key development stage.


The impact of this early support cannot be underestimated. It builds resilience, encourages healthy lifestyles and aids social and emotional development.

Health visitors lead on the delivery of the government’s healthy child programme for children aged 0 to five, working alongside other health and social care colleagues, including family nurse partnership teams, nursery nurses and other specialist health professionals.
